Transaction 815f66892cf81e322107034be74162dfba90eee61edac77681e6bdf4f1d7fb57
1 Input
1 Output
-
815f66892cf81e322107034be74162dfba90eee61edac77681e6bdf4f1d7fb57:0
- value
- 998638
- script pubkey
- OP_0 OP_PUSHBYTES_20 d676c5dbe86cfa4c2a78018829cedbf5935d6613
- address
- bc1q6emvtklgdnayc2ncqxyznnkm7kf46esna9wcf6